JOB SUMMARY

The damage prevention supervisor provides first line supervision and oversight of day-to-day gas damage prevention operations activities while maintaining a high level of safety and compliance performance within the damage prevention group. The damage prevention supervisor is responsible for ensuring that all gas facilities are located and marked in a timely fashion and in compliance with all Department of Transportation (“DOT”) regulations and State dig laws. Under the leadership of the damage prevention supervisor, the damage prevention function is responsible for the monitoring, inspection and surveillance of outside contractors performing excavation to protect the integrity of Entergy’s gas facilities per company practices and procedures and at the direction of pipeline safety regulators. The damage prevention supervisor also coordinates and participates in various industry and community public awareness events in alignment with the gas business’ public awareness plan.

JOB DUTIES/RESPONSIBILITIES

Utilize all Entergy safety work practices and procedures to safely perform all daily task including hazard assessments, vehicle inspections, attendance of safety meetings and reporting of near misses through Entergy’s close calls/good catches program.

Supervise personnel performance and resolve employee conflicts or concerns. Manage damage prevention work assignments to ensure the group is responding appropriately to department and organizational needs.

Achieve operational excellence by setting and communicating aggressive performance expectations, learning/teaching process improvements, measuring/monitoring performance levels, providing feedback and coaching performance improvements to employees. Conduct field safety and operator qualification audits with employees. Qualify employees to perform assigned covered task per company’s Qualified Pipeline Personal (“QPP”) plan. Co-champion and periodically review procedures establishing damage prevention work practices (e.g.,O-P-000-1 “Damage Prevention Procedure”).

Manage and oversee the scheduling and assigning of gas locate tickets for Entergy’s gas business. Ensure all locates are done within the required time dictated by State dig laws and in compliance with applicable pipeline safety regulations (i.e., Part 192.614 “Damage Prevention Program”).

Assign and manage work for conflict resolution crew to perform pre-construction field assessments, conduct ongoing coordination with excavators to daylight, relocate, verify line locations and mark gas facilities.

Work with and provide input to the Entergy‘s public affairs organization when necessary for State dig law improvements. Be an active member of local damage prevention organizations such as Capital Area Utility Risk Partnerships (“CAURP”), Regional Common Ground Alliance, Louisiana Damage Prevention Summit Committee, Louisiana Gas Association Damage Prevention Committee and other related organizations working with other utilities for census or issues and build recommendations for process and procedure improvements.

Work with Louisiana One Call to improve operational processes targeting reduction in overall ticket volume which will result in Operations and Maintenance (“O&M”) reductions. Be willing to become an active member of any Louisiana One Call committee.

Coordinate, work and support various events/activities to promote gas public awareness, including local Home & Garden Shows; Diggers Night Out events; Damage Prevention Summit; Pipeline Association of Louisiana events and any other event that supports the gas public awareness plan.

Manage and complete all complaints for the damage prevention group to ensure a satisfactory completion. Work with claims management to investigate and resolve damages to Entergy gas facilities.

Lead gas damage investigations by conducting investigations or reviewing investigations done by others to insure accuracy and appropriate actions are taken against excavators, including damage claims for recovering cost, providing feedback, conduct safety presentations to excavators and filing complaints with State dig law enforcement agencies. Establish a relationship with contractors to ensure gas facilities are properly understood and maintained to eliminate third party damages.

Process and audit all damage prevention invoices. Track and analyze locate ticket types and identify trends for process improvement opportunities. Manage all expenditures, including any joint expenditure with other departments to achieve cost performance targets while maintaining and meeting all locate expenditures. Lead, develop and implement projects that improve overall processes, procedures and performance.

Communicate to affected customers job related information and explanation for why we are marking on or in front of their property.
